Output 6975c82104e0586636f1827f2671b90853969086300df84b8cdfab98284f92db:0

value
1014663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51b0d580fb1785a18668f7e81f6a034524a99139 OP_EQUALVERIFY OP_CHECKSIG
address
18SwaBSJyCbcyT58T16UuqXRW79fpfK7zG
transaction
6975c82104e0586636f1827f2671b90853969086300df84b8cdfab98284f92db
spent
true